Sennheiser Launching New Products at CES! (And We'll Be There!)
I recently received an invitation from Sennheiser to cover a special product launch on January 6, 2008 at CES in Las Vegas (the night before CES officially opens), and I'm takin' it. We'll have the scoop, and will have the first public listen in the world to these products. I'll also be covering it, on the spot, via a Podcast and on the forums. I received an ahead-of-time teaser, and what we are going to see/hear--considering all the speculation this year--is, in my opinion, probably unexpected from Sennheiser.
